Brazil

Physical warmth and improvisation; personal space is small and joy is public.

What we have written up

All 262 places in Brazil →

Worth knowing before you go

  • Cards and Pix dominate; cash is fading in cities
  • Tipping: 10% is usually already on restaurant bills
  • Domestic flights are the practical connector - distances are vast

Argentina

Italian passion speaking Spanish; dinner at ten, opinions at full volume, mate shared always.

What we have written up

All 262 places in Argentina →

Worth knowing before you go

  • Tipping is around 10% in cash
  • Cards work but cash and payment apps sometimes get better effective rates - check current practice
  • Long-distance buses are excellent - full-flat seats cross the huge country overnight
